| General Characteristics | |
| Displacement: | 2,300 tons standard / 2,520 tons full load |
| Length: | 340 ft o/a |
| Beam: | 40 ft |
| Draught: | 16 ft |
| Propulsion: | 8 x ASR1 diesels, 12,400 shp, 2 shafts |
| Speed: | 24 knots |
| Range: | 220 tons oil fuel, 7,500 nm at 16 knots |
| Complement: | 235 |
| Armament: | 2 x twin 4.5 in gun Mark 6 1 x twin 40mm Bofors gun STAAG Mark 2, later; 1 x single 40mm Bofors gun Mark 7 1 x Squid A/S mortar |
| Radar: | Type 960 air search, later; Type 965 AKE-1 air search Type 293Q target indication, later; Type 993 target indication Type 277Q height finding Type 974 navigation Type 285 fire control on director Mark 6M Type 262 fire control on director CRBF Type 262 fire control on STAAG mount Type 1010 Cossor Mark 10 IFF |
| Sonar: | Type 174 search Type 170 attack |
The Leopard class were a series of British anti-aircraft defence frigates built for the Royal Navy.
